All You Need To Know About EPS 200 Mm

Expanded Polystyrene (EPS) is a versatile material that is widely used in construction for its lightweight and insulating properties EPS comes in various thicknesses and densities to suit different applications, with EPS 200 mm being a popular choice for projects that require a higher level of thermal insulation.

EPS 200 mm refers to EPS sheets or boards that are 200 millimeters thick This thickness provides a higher level of insulation compared to thinner EPS sheets, making it ideal for use in walls, floors, and roofs where thermal efficiency is a priority The density of EPS 200 mm can vary depending on the manufacturer and specific requirements of the project.

One of the key benefits of using EPS 200 mm is its excellent thermal insulation properties EPS is a closed-cell foam material that traps air within its structure, creating a barrier against heat transfer The 200 mm thickness enhances this barrier, reducing heat loss in the winter and heat gain in the summer This can result in lower energy bills and a more comfortable indoor environment.

In addition to thermal insulation, EPS 200 mm also offers other benefits for construction projects Its lightweight nature makes it easy to handle and install, reducing labor costs and the need for heavy machinery EPS is also resistant to moisture, mold, and pests, making it a durable and long-lasting insulation solution.

EPS 200 mm can be used in a variety of applications in both residential and commercial buildings In walls, it can be installed between studs or as an external insulation layer to improve the overall thermal performance of the building envelope In floors, EPS 200 mm can be placed under concrete slabs to prevent heat loss to the ground And in roofs, it can be used as part of a ventilated or unventilated roof system to provide insulation and moisture control.

In terms of environmental sustainability, EPS 200 mm has a relatively low environmental impact compared to other insulation materials EPS is recyclable and can be reused in a closed-loop system, reducing waste and conserving resources Additionally, EPS manufacturing processes have become more energy-efficient in recent years, further reducing their carbon footprint.

One consideration when using EPS 200 mm is fire safety While EPS is flammable, it is treated with flame retardants during manufacturing to improve its fire resistance Building codes may also require additional fire protection measures when using EPS insulation, such as the installation of fire barriers or sprinkler systems It is important to consult with local authorities and fire safety experts to ensure compliance with all regulations.
